Making games work under Windows Vista.
Mark Overmars:"Games created with Game Maker versions 6.0 and 6.1 are not compatible with Windows Vista. The best you can do is upgrade to version 7.0 of Game Maker before you create the final version of your game.However, if this is impossible, there is a little tool to convert games created with versions 6.0 and 6.1 into a file that is compatible with WIndows Vista.Please understand that this tool is provided AS IS without any warranty. It is just a quick hack and should be used with care. Always first make a copy of your game.Please realise that you are not allowed to redistribute converted games unless you are the creator or copyright holder of the original game."
